This 1981 Commander 1000, registration N695CS, presents a well-maintained turboprop with a 6,400-hour airframe and remarkably low-time engines. Both Honeywell TPE331-10 engines have only 900 hours since overhaul against a 5,000-hour TBO, supported by fresh 5-year inspections and Hartzell wide-chord speed propellers with 100 hours since overhaul. The aircraft has undergone long-term service center maintenance and features an upgraded Enviro Systems environmental package, Keith freon air, and known ice protection.
